你查询的IP:[119.78.8.26]  地理位置:中国科技网

最新查询118.178.23.126 120.192.199.239 123.138.159.27 221.129.128.98 125.169.143.58 202.93.92.16 221.129.147.151 167.139.27.83 116.116.221.177 119.78.8.26 203.212.18.49 61.128.192.230 221.199.224.125 124.192.52.93 121.4.26.132 118.84.144.90 124.192.100.16 218.249.10.138 58.144.3.110 120.72.32.128 203.100.32.229 60.200.53.160 220.112.73.127 210.56.192.34 203.119.24.143 202.125.176.108 123.128.52.53 117.74.64.106 114.28.111.188 117.106.209.108 203.119.32.49